Transaction 80507e67c41ffeb8d6975b6463d969d7aebe9eb8f21bd2028a75d486ab44106a
1 Input
2 Outputs
- 80507e67c41ffeb8d6975b6463d969d7aebe9eb8f21bd2028a75d486ab44106a:0
- 80507e67c41ffeb8d6975b6463d969d7aebe9eb8f21bd2028a75d486ab44106a:1
value 29000000
address 3Ck6cW6X3JSCBj1nKk3MWwpFwUK6pCJMEr
value 3145962644
address 12sLnvpRRr4DcXd3sDZVqo4PKMq7YkQkx5